History:
This mod is a continuation of a mod I made for Fallout 3 called Nuke Gun. Check out the video from 2009 below! The mod I bring you now is the way I always wanted the Nuke Gun to be. Today, it is called the Primordial NG-2.
The NG-2 is the pinnacle of advanced experimental weaponry created before the war. It didn't see much usage in combat before the bombs fell but did well in testing. There is only one. The video below shows where to get it.



How it works:
The NG-2 is a specialized Minigun made to fire a unique variant of 5mm rounds. These are called ExNG-2 Rounds. They look like normal rounds but their appearance consists of a steel casing (apposed to bronze) and a smiley face on the bullet. See photos! Even in vats, you can see the smiley face! Within the bullet is a hidden micro explosive. These rounds unleash a miniature atomic blast upon impact. Like a Fatman, except full auto and there is no bullet drop. They go straight for their target and then obliterate it. The best perk about this weapon is that there is no blindly bright light from the detonations due to the custom explosion I created. Shoot as much as you want, you won't be blinded.

This weapon is completely customizable at a weapon workbench.  

How to get:
The video above shows a video process on obtaining it. But it's fairly simple. West to the Atom Cats, there is a Military Checkpoint consisting of 2 APC's on a barge with containers. Most likely, a Mr. Gutsy will be guarding the area. Next to the APC's, there's a security gate. Inside you will find the weapon and its ammo.
For more ammo, use "player.additem XX000814 <insert amount here>". XX is your load order. Don't actually put XX in there. Or you can craft it at a chem station.

Compatibility or anything else I should know??
This mod modifies the WorldSpace. Most likely, you won't encounter any problems as most modders on the nexus aren't familiar with placing objects into the world without the Creation Kit. Furthermore, they would have to edit this cell that the NG-2 is located in. Very unlikely. But things happen you know. 

Frame rate does drop a bit during extended use of pulling the trigger. But it's nothing that bad. I minimized the damage to your frames as best I could!
